PHIL 201 - Ethics in America

Institution:
Charter Oak State College
Subject:
Description:
This course examines contemporary ethical conflicts and provides grounding in the language, concepts, and traditions of ethics. Students are provided the intellectual tools with which to analyze moral dilemmas in the fields they choose to pursue, and in the society in which all of us live.
